Sump Pump Overflow Water Removal Cost in Severn, MD
The cost of sump pump overflow water remov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Severn, MD. Here are some estimated price ranges for common services: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Removal | $500 – $2,500 | The size of the affected area and the amount of water present. |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$1,000 – $5,000 | The size of the affected area and the level of moisture present. |
| Cleaning and Sanitizing | $500 – $2,000 | The level of contamination and the size of the affected area. |
| Restoration and Reconstruction | $2,000 – $10,000 | The level of damage and the size of the affected area. |
| Equipment Rental | $100 – $500 | The type and quantity of equipment needed. |
| Disinfection and Odor Removal | $200 – $1,000 | The level of contamination and the size of the affected area. |

Common Questions About Sump Pump Overflow Water Removal
Q: What causes a sump pump to overflow?
A: A sump pump can overflow due to various reasons, including power outages, clogs, or improper installation. Our team can help you identify the source of the issue and provide a solution.
Q: How long does it take to remove sump pump overflow water?
A: The time it takes to remove sump pump overflow water depends on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area. Our team can provide a more accurate estimate after an on-site assessment.
